Microsoft Expression Web - using FTP to publish to your website space Print

  • 0

you can publish you web site from within Expression Web.

With Expression Web Open and Your computer's Web Site folder Open, do the following:

1.  Click   File >  Publish Web site

2.  The Remote Site Dialog box opens.  [see below]  Choose FTP, and type in ftp.yoursite.com .  Enter the ftp directory location:  usually public_html. If you don't specify the correct directory, you won't see your pages after you publish them. 

 

ftp

Arrow 1:  choose the ftp option

Arrow 2:  type in ftp.your domain name.com.  No, it's not a typo in the photo above.  EW adds the ftp:// in front of ftp. your website. com.

Arrow 3:  Type in the directory you will publish the files to. 

** on our web servers this is always public_html.
